Fonaments de la psicobiologiaFundamentos de la psicobiologíaPsychobiology basics  (3101G01056)

The contents of the module will be ordered through the following thematic blocks: 1.Biology and psychology: the theory of evolution as the backbone of biopsychology.Evolutionary psychologies: sociobiology, ethology, evolutionary psychology.2.Genetics and behaviour: from Mendel to molecular genetics.Structure and function of genes.Protein synthesis and gene regulation.Quantitative genetics.3.Neurobiology: neurons, nerve impulses, potentials, synapses, neurotransmitters.Structures of the nervous system.4.Behavioural physiology: neurosciences, psychophysiology, physiological psychology.Systems: nervous, endocrine, immune.Physiological bases of different activities.

Fonaments de psicologiaFundamentos de psicologíaPsychology basics  (3101G01057)

The contents of the module will be ordered through the following thematic blocks: 1.What is the Psychology.The object of study of the Psychology.Utility and function of the psychological knowledge.2.History of the Psychology: the Psychology in the Philosophy.The scientific Psychology.The psychological hospital.Theoretical paradigms and prospects of psychology.3.Epistemology of Psychology:.epistemological referents of Psychology.Characteristics of psychological knowledge and how it is formed.4.Psychological research methodology.Qualitative and quantitative research.Stages of the research process.Studies of observation and survey.Experiments and quasi-experiments.Classification of the methods and techniques of qualitative research.5.Bibliographical research.Bibliographical databases.The APA document citation format and presenting research reports.

Anàlisi de dades en psicologia 1Análisis de datos en psicología 1Data analysis in Psychology I  (3101G01001)

The content of this subject will be arranged into the following thematic blocks.• Introduction to descriptive statistics.o Organising and representing data.o Ranking measures.o Central trend measures.o Distribution measures.o Typical scores and derivative scales.o Descriptive statistics with two variables.•Foundations of probability theory.o Random variables.o Models of probability distribution.o Statistics sample distributions.• Quantitative research design.o Designs with independent samples.o Designs with related samples.• Data analysis with the SPSS statistics package.o Construction of a data matrix.o Descriptive analysis of data.

Percepció, atenció, memòria i interaccióPercepción , atención, memoria e interacciónPerception, attention, memory and interaction   (3101G01058)

The contents of the module will be ordered through the following thematic blocks: 1.Neurobiological bases of perception, attention and memory: sensory organs, sensory perception.Structures and neuromodulators involved in memory.Ageing and disorders.Structures involved in attention.2.Perception: sensation and perception from a classical and modern psychophysical perspective.Social perception.The influence of social context on contemporary perception.Attention: determinants and functions.3.Psychology of memory and representation.Structural approach (sensory memories, long-term and working).Process approach: the hypothesis of depth of mental processing.Representational approach: networks, distributed representation, outlines, mental images and propositions.
